Output 34a3528e49771decf72ba4c4493a66380666e53623153e79577db3a3b7934c36:2

value
44067862
script pubkey
OP_0 OP_PUSHBYTES_32 85641098e61640000911a55cd09e3f5e8ead4ec8d345b7494c43ccd77d0b4dd9
address
bc1qs4jppx8xzeqqqzg354wdp83lt6826nkg6dzmwj2vg0xdwlgtfhvs0ryykj
transaction
34a3528e49771decf72ba4c4493a66380666e53623153e79577db3a3b7934c36